Category: AMD Versal™ AI Edge Series Gen 2 (Payload Profiles / SOSA™ / VPX / SoM)
This category covers next-generation, high-density adaptive compute boards, 3U OpenVPX (SOSA™-aligned payload profiles like SLT3-PAY-1F1U1S1S1U1U4F1J-*), and System-on-Modules (SoMs) built on the AMD Versal™ AI Edge Gen 2 Adaptive SoC family (e.g., 2VE3858 / 2VE3804 / 2VE3558 devices).
Positioned as the successor to standard MPSoC/Versal Gen 1 architecture, Gen 2 combines all three processing phases—Preprocessing, AI Inference, and Postprocessing—onto a single silicon die. It integrates high-performance CPUs, real-time cores, upgraded AI Engine-ML v2 tiles, hardware-hardened Image Signal Processors (ISPs), and programmable logic.
Key Highlights
-
Heterogeneous Single-Chip Compute:
-
Application Processing Unit (APU): Up to 8x Arm® Cortex®-A78AE cores (up to 2.2 GHz) providing massive scalar CPU compute (over 3x the performance of Cortex-A53).
-
Real-Time Processing Unit (RPU): Up to 10x Arm® Cortex®-R52 cores for safety-critical, low-latency control (ASIL D / SIL 3 capable) .
-
AI Engines: Up to 144 AIE-ML v2 tiles supporting new numeric formats (FP8, FP16, MX6, MX9) for up to 3x performance/watt gains over Gen 1 AI E.
-
-
Hardened Vision & Graphics Accelerators:
-
Hardened ISP Tiles: Live multi-camera streaming (>1 Gpix/s throughput per tile) to process raw CMOS image sensor data without burning programmable logic resourc es.
-
Graphics & Video: Integrated 4-core Arm Mali™-G78AE GPU and hardened 4K60 Video Codec Units (VC Us).
-
-
Extreme Memory & High-Speed Connectivity:
-
System Memory: High-bandwidth LPDDR5X (up to 8533 Mb/s) and DDR5 (up to 6400 Mb/s) control lers.
-
High-Speed Transceivers: PCIe Gen5 support, 100G multirate Ethernet, and 32G GTYP transce ivers.
